Saint-Affrique-Belmont Airfield
Saint-Affrique-Belmont Airfield (LFIF) is a general-aviation airfield serving Belmont-sur-Rance, Aveyron, Occitanie. The field lies at 1,686 ft (514 m) above sea level and has a single runway of 4,265 ft (1,300 m), asphalt. Its nearest neighbour is Bédarieux La Tour Airfield (LFNX), 21 nm ESE.
